 <p>On April 17, 2020, Nanophase Technologies Corporation (together with its subsidiary, the &#8220;Company&#8221;) entered into a promissory note, dated as of April 16, 2020 (the &#8220;Note&#8221;) in favor of Libertyville Bank and Trust Company, N.A. (the &#8220;Lender&#8221;) evidencing a loan in the aggregate principal amount of $951,600 (the &#8220;Loan&#8221;) pursuant to the Paycheck Protection Program (the &#8220;PPP&#8221;) under Division A, Title I of Coronavirus Aid, Relief, and Economic Security Act (&#8220;CARES Act&#8221;), which was enacted on March 27, 2020.<br /> <br /><em>Interest Rate</em><br /> <br />The interest rate on the Loan is 1.00% per year.<br /> <br /><em>Maturity</em><br /> <br />The term of the Loan is two years. The Company will be required to pay any unforgiven principle and interest in eighteen equal monthly installments, with the first payment being due on November 17, 2020 and continuing on the same day of each subsequent month until the date of maturity. The Loan may be prepaid by the Company at any time prior to maturity with no prepayment penalties.<br /> <br /><em>Potential Loan Forgiveness</em><br /> <br />Under the PPP, the Company may apply for forgiveness of the amount due on the Loan in an amount equal to the sum of the following costs incurred during the 8-week period beginning on the date of the first disbursement of the Loan: (a) payroll costs, (b) any payment of interest on a covered obligation (which shall not include any prepayment of or payment of principal on a covered mortgage obligation), (c) any payment on a covered rent obligation, and (d) any covered utility payment, calculated in accordance with the terms of the CARES Act. No assurance can be provided that the Company will obtain forgiveness of the Loan in whole or in part.<br /> <br /><em>Events of Default</em><br /> <br />The Loan provides for customary events of default, including payment defaults, cross-defaults on any other loan with the lender, and breaches of the terms of the Note.  <p align="justify">ROMEOVILLE, Ill., April  21, 2020  (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Nanophase Technologies Corporation (OTCQB: NANX), a leader in minerals-based personal care ingredients and formulated products for protecting skin from environmental aggressors, such as UV light and pollution, today reported that it received funding in the form of a loan under the Paycheck Protection Program (the &#8220;PPP&#8221;),&#160;under Division A, Title I of&#160;Coronavirus Aid, Relief, and Economic Security Act&#160;(&#8220;CARES Act&#8221;), which was enacted on March 27, 2020.<br ></p>  <p align="justify">&#8220;We are happy to announce that our request for funding under the PPP was granted, being funded on April 17, 2020. The amount of the loan was $0.95 million. We believe that we will incur costs over the next eight weeks amounting to at least 80% of the loan balance, which we expect to be forgiven under the terms of the PPP,&#8221; stated Jess Jankowski, President and CEO. &#8220;We plan on continuing operations, taking necessary precautions to protect our employees, their families, and our community during this disruption, as we manufacture products and ingredients within sectors that are part of our nation&#8217;s critical infrastructure. We are both honored and proud to be contributing to our national public health, economic security, and safety through the materials we make for use in medical diagnostics.&#8221;&#160;</p>  <p align="justify">&#8220;We are working to complete our quarterly review prior to release of our Q12020 financial results, which we plan to make available in early May. As I mentioned in our most recent financial release, we have visibility through Q22020, and now through July. We don&#8217;t expect to have better visibility for the second half of 2020 until late May or early June,&#8221; added Jankowski.&#160;</p>  <p align="justify">&#8220;Our top priorities remain our people and their families, our neighbors, our customers, and contributing in any way that we can to help our nation in these difficult circumstances.&#8221; &#160;</p>  <p align="justify"><strong><u>About Nanophase Technologies</u></strong><br >Nanophase Technologies Corporation (NANX), <u>www.nanophase.com</u>, is a leader in minerals-based personal care ingredients and formulated products for protecting skin from environmental aggressors, such as UV light and pollution, as well as providing solutions for industrial product applications.
